Monthly Snowfall Comparison
| Month | Palisades Tahoe (cm) | Deer Valley (cm) |
|---|---|---|
| November | 57.7 | 35.7 |
| December | 123.3 | 52.9 |
| January | 137.6 | 64.9 |
| February | 127.9 | 56.8 |
| March | 137.2 | 61.2 |
| April | 44.2 | 32.7 |
Which Resort Gets More Snow?
Based on 10 years of data, Palisades Tahoe receives more annual snowfall (662cm) compared to Deer Valley (342cm) — a difference of 320cm per year. The best month for powder at Palisades Tahoe is January (58% probability), while Deer Valley's best is January (43% probability).
